Sports fields now open

As warm weather approaches, many residents and sports leagues will use one of the 30 City sports fields to enjoy activities ranging from Frisbee to baseball. Yesterday marked the official opening of all City sports fields, including public washrooms which are now open until 8 p.m.

Throughout the season, City staff will perform routine maintenance that requires field closures. Users are encouraged to go online to view the 2014 Sport Field Maintenance Schedule which lists the closures throughout the spring and summer months.

To keep teams practicing, a number of fields are available free of charge. Using the practice fields and staying off regular fields during closures lets the turf be repaired more quickly so that teams can get back on high quality fields faster.
